The Formula for Percentage Decrease
The formula to calculate percentage decrease is straightforward:Percentage Decrease = ((Original Value - New Value) / Original Value) * 100Let's break it down:
- Original Value: The starting number before the decrease.
- New Value: The number after the decrease.

Example 1: Calculating Percentage Decrease in Sales
Suppose a company's sales dropped from $5,000 to $3,500. Here's how to calculate the percentage decrease:((5000 - 3500) / 5000) * 100 = 30%Result: The sales decreased by 30%.
What to check for: Ensure the original value is correctly identified and that the subtraction is accurate.

Example 2: Calculating Percentage Decrease in Weight
If someone's weight drops from 180 lbs to 160 lbs, the percentage decrease is:((180 - 160) / 180) * 100 = 11.11%Result: The weight decreased by approximately 11.11%.
What to check for: Ensure the units are consistent and the values are accurate.
